A phrase is a group of words commonly used together (e.g., once upon a time).
phrase
a. cuando eras niño
A word or phrase used to refer to the second person informal “tú” by their conjugation or implied context (e.g., How are you?).
(informal)
A word or phrase that is singular (e.g., el gato).
(singular)
What did you do for fun when you were a kid?¿Qué hacías para divertirte cuando eras niño?
b. cuando era niño
A word or phrase used to refer to the second person formal “usted” by their conjugation or implied context (e.g., usted).
(formal)
A word or phrase that is singular (e.g., el gato).
(singular)
What was Buenos Aires like when you were a kid?¿Cómo era Bueno Aires cuando era niño?
c. de niño
Did you play sports when you were a kid?¿Practicabas deporte de niño?
